Foreclosure House Hunting in The Central Michigan Dream area of Flint

The central Michigan city of Flint has stayed fairly steady in the ratings as far as Foreclosed homes go.

Flint foreclosure homes if you look at the numbers seem to have remained fairly consistent over the course of the recent real estate crash that the country is in the midst of. In fact, Flint is one of the few cities in the state of Michigan of any size that has actually seen the overall numbers in the city drop with regards to the foreclosure rate.

Part of the reason that the state is having such a large issue with the foreclosure rate is that the unemployment rate in the state is well into record territory. Flint is an exception and as a result the numbers there seem to be stable and even falling a bit and that is a nice thing for the folks that call this city home, especially the homeowners.

The state as a whole is one of the worst in terms of unemployment and until those numbers are eased there is little to no hope that the current foreclosure trend is likely to reverse or even slow significantly.

The homes that you are likely to find in the foreclosure market in the area in and around Flint will for the most part be older well made construction in fairly good repair with a few pockets of subdivisions that are more modern construction which will be located closer to the retail and industrial areas of the city.

Flint as a city is doing what it can to help to combat the problem and attempt to help homeowners to stay the tide and keep the numbers of foreclosures at bay and they appear to be having some success in this area. If the current trend in unemployment in the area around Flint holds then there is a possibility that the city can continue to buck the statewide foreclosure trend.
